期刊文献+

RAID-VCR:一种能够承受三个磁盘故障的RAID结构 被引量:10

RAID-VCR:A New RAID Architecture for Tolerating Triple Disk Failures
下载PDF
导出
摘要 提出了一种新RAID结构———RAIDVCR.这种结构仅需要3个额外的磁盘来保存校验信息,但是却能够承受任意模式的3个成员磁盘故障.与现有的其它RAID结构相比,RAIDVCR的容灾能力大幅提高,但是对磁盘空间利用率和系统吞吐量的影响却非常小.RAIDVCR的编码和解码过程都是基于简单的XOR操作,并且以明文方式保存了用户数据,从而可以高效地执行读操作.仿真实验结果表明,RAIDVCR的编码和解码性能较好,具有很好的应用前景. Although almost all vendors enhance the availability of their storage systems by levering RAID technology to achieve redundant storage, there is currently no feasible RAID architecture being able to tolerate simultaneous failures of three member disks. To improve the fault-tolerant capability of RAID structure, this paper introduces a novel RAID structure named RAIDVCR which taking advantage of CR coding techniques used in telecommunication while making some modification to adapt to the characteristics of storage systems. The encoding and decoding procedure of RAID-VCR are based on XOR operations, and the computing complexity is quadrat- ic in the number of data disks. This makes it quite simple and feasible. According to mathematical proof and experiments, RAID-VCR could improve the fault-tolerant capability remarkably and tolerate triple simultaneous disk failures in any pattern with only three extra disks for parity information, while makes few negative influences on system's throughput and disk capacity utilization.
出处 《计算机学报》 EI CSCD 北大核心 2006年第5期792-800,共9页 Chinese Journal of Computers
基金 国家自然科学基金(60373108)资助.
关键词 冗余存储 抗删除编码 RAID 容灾 VCR码 redundant storage erasure resilient code, RAID fault tolerance VCR code
  • 相关文献

参考文献10

  • 1Schulze M,Gibson G.A,Katz R.H,Patterson D.A..How reliable is a RAID.In:Proceedings of the IEEE COMPCON,San Francisco,CA,1989,118~123 被引量:1
  • 2Patterson D,Gibson G,Katz R..A case for redundant arrays of inexpensive disks (RAID).In:Proceedings of the ACM SIGMOD International Conference on Management of Data,Chicago,1988,109~116 被引量:1
  • 3Blaum M,Brady J.et al.EVENODD:An optimal scheme for tolerating double disk failures in RAID architectures.In:Proceedings of the 21st Annual International Symposium on Computer Architecture,Chicago,1994,245~254 被引量:1
  • 4Alvarez G.A,Burkhard W.A,Cristian F..Tolerating multiple failures in RAID architectures with optimal storage and uniform declustering.In:Proceedings of the 24th Annual International Symposium on Computer Architecture,Colorado,1997,62~72 被引量:1
  • 5Jin Fan.An investigation on new complex rotary codes.In:Proceedings of the IEEE ISIT85,Brighton,UK,1985,1~8 被引量:1
  • 6Park Chong-Won,Han Young-Year.A practical parity scheme for tolerating triple disk failures in RAID architectures.In:Proceedings of the International Conference on Parallel and Distributed Processing Techniques and Applications,Penang,Malaysia,2000,58~68 被引量:1
  • 7Tau Chih-Shing,Wang Tzone-I.Efficient parity placement schemes for tolerating triple disk failures in RAID architectures.In:Proceedings of the 17th International Conference on Advanced Information Networking and Applications,Xi ′an,2003,132~139 被引量:1
  • 8Sivathanu M,Prabhakaran V..Improving storage system availability with D-GRAID.In:Proceedings of the 3rd USENIX Conference on File and Storage Technologies,San Francisco,2004,15~30 被引量:1
  • 9Blaum M,Roth R.M..New array codes for multiple phased burst correction.IEEE Transactions on Information Theory,1993,39(1):66~77 被引量:1
  • 10Feng Dan,Jin Hai,Zhang Jiang-Ling.Improved EVENODD code.In:Proceedings of the IEEE International Symposium on Information Theory,Ulm Germany,1997,261~262 被引量:1

同被引文献100

  • 1周可,冯丹,王芳,张江陵.网络磁盘阵列流水调度研究[J].计算机学报,2005,28(3):319-325. 被引量:13
  • 2王祚栋,魏少军.SOC时代低功耗设计的研究与进展[J].微电子学,2005,35(2):174-179. 被引量:19
  • 3刘苗,陈海鹏,温子彦,康辉.基于LVM与Sof-RAID的网格存储体系结构[J].吉林大学学报(信息科学版),2006,24(5):526-529. 被引量:3
  • 4FENG G L, DENG R, BAO F, et al. New efficient MDS array codes for RAID, Part I.. Reed Solomon like codes for tolerating three disk failures [J]. IEEE Trans Computers, 2005, 54(9): 1071-1080. 被引量:1
  • 5LEE H R, KIM O, AHN G, et al. A low-jitter 5000 ppm spread spectrum clock generator for multi-channel SATA transceiver in 0.18μm CMOS [C]//IEEE Inter Sol Sta Circ Conf. San Francisco, CA, USA. 2005: 162-163. 被引量:1
  • 6Working Draft American National Standard: Information Technology - AT Attachment - 8 ATA/ATAPI Command Set (ATAS-ACS) [S]. 2008. 被引量:1
  • 7HAFNER J L. HoVer Erasure Codes for Disk Arrays[R]. IBM Re- search Division, FJ10352(A0507-015), 2005. 被引量:1
  • 8HAFNER J L. WEAVER codes: Highly fault tolerant erasure codes for storage systems[A]. ACM FAST2005[C]. Berkeley, CA, USA, 2005 211-224. 被引量:1
  • 9MACWILLIAMS F J, SLOANE N J A. The Theory of Error Correct- ing Codes[M]. North-holland Publishing Company, 1977. 被引量:1
  • 10FENG G L, DENG R, BAO F, et al. New efficient MDS array codes for RAID, part I: reed Solomon like codes for tolerating three disk failures[J]. IEEE Transactions on Computers, 2005, 54(9): 1071-1080. 被引量:1

引证文献10

二级引证文献31

相关作者

内容加载中请稍等...

相关机构

内容加载中请稍等...

相关主题

内容加载中请稍等...

浏览历史

内容加载中请稍等...
;
使用帮助 返回顶部